DEVELOPMLENT OF A LAUNDRY MONITOR FOR DETECTION OF HOT PARTICLE CONTAMINATION
SBC: Shonka Research Associates Topic: N/ATWO APPROACHES WILL BE EXAMINED TO SIGNIFICANTLY IMPROVE THESENSITIVITY OF LAUNDRY MONITORS TO DETECT AND SPECIFY LOCATION OF HOT PARTICLES ON LAUNDERED GARMENTS. THESE PROPOSED TECNIQUES HAVE HIGH POTENTIAL FOR DETECTING BOTH LOW ENERGY BETA AND ALPHA PARTICLE RADIATION AS WELL AS IMPROVING SENSITIVITY BY REDUCING BACKGROUND COUNT RATE.

ELECTROMAGNETIC ENVIRONMENTAL EFFECTS WITHIN A NUCLEAR POWER PLANT
SBC: MISSION RESEARCH CORP. Topic: N/AMRC PROPOSES TO DEVELOP A SAFETY PERFORMANCE INDICATOR (PI) OF THE ELECTROMAGNETIC (EM) PROTECTION STATUS OF A NUCLEAR POWER PLANT (NPP). WE BELIEVE THAT SUCH A PI IS NEEDED BECAUSE: (1) EM ENVIRONMENTAL POLLUTION IS ON THE INCREASE,(2) ADDITIONAL EM THREATS MUST BE EVALUATED, AND (3) DISRUPTION OF NPP OPERATIONS BY EM EFFECTS CAN AND MUST BE AVOIDED.
